Factors Affecting Breath-Holding Ability

Several factors can affect how long painted turtles can hold their breath. Some of these include:

Age and Size

Generally speaking, adult painted turtles are better at holding their breath than juveniles. This is because young turtles have smaller lungs and are still developing their respiratory capabilities. Additionally, larger turtles can hold their breath for longer periods of time than smaller ones, allowing them to withstand longer dives.

Activity Level and Metabolic Rate

Like with many animals, a painted turtle’s ability to hold its breath is influenced by its activity level and metabolic rate. If a turtle is swimming actively or has a high metabolic rate, it may need to surface more frequently to take a breath. On the other hand, if a turtle is resting or inactive, it may be able to hold its breath for longer periods of time.

Painted turtles are ectotherms, meaning their body temperature is regulated by the temperature of their environment. Warmer water temperatures can increase a turtle’s metabolic rate, causing it to need more oxygen and breathe more frequently. Conversely, colder water temperatures can decrease a turtle’s metabolic rate, allowing it to conserve oxygen and hold its breath for longer periods of time.
